Abstract

The course is aimed at students' clear understanding of the principles and practice of modern international trade both at national and international levels, as well as methods of work at foreign markets and ways of interaction with foreign partners in the framework of various types of international economic transactions.Pre-requisitesIntroduction to International RelationsIntroduction to EconomicsBusiness FinanceComparative Area Studies

  • This course aims to explore the important concepts and issues in International trade.
  • The study of international trade involves economy- wide issues such as conventional comparative advantage, Increasing returns to scale, trade between firms and trade policies.
  • Students who successfully complete this course should have an understanding of trade patterns and their analysis logic in order to make basic decisions on issues in International Trade.
  • To achieve these goals, this course provides basic concepts and principles of the world trade, specifically concerning the theory and corporate policy.
  • The first half of the course covers trade theories-Ricardian model, Heckscher Ohlin model, Economies of scale, TNCs and Foreign Direct Investment, while the second half of the course will cover the more practical effects of trade policy, trading channels and market entry patterns, International trade environments and finally Trade development policies.
